Intel announces a new ISA to compete with ARM >30% - Not particularly likely in 2022 but more likely in 2023 and beyond Apple is selling a TON of Macs with M1 processors and these processors are very fast. TheRegister writes Arm's market share in PC chips was about eight per cent during Q3 this year, climbing steadily from seven per cent in Q2, and up from only two per cent in Q3 2020, before Arm-compatible M1 Macs went on sale. Apple's ARM based processors use an ISA (Instruction Set Architecture) that is newer and better designed than the x86 one used by Intel and AMD. While switching ISAs is a huge undertaking, users of the x86 ISA have higher power consumption and larger silicon area to perform the same operations. #2. Recognition for SAR-CoV-2 / C...

Tesla appears to be actively limiting the performance of their cars - Update: Tesla has confirmed and backed away

Tesla owners have noticed a change in the behavior of their cars, specifically in the performance models such as the P85 and the P90DL, where the performance of the cars doesn't seem to match previous or listed results. User wk057 has done some pretty extensive reverse engineering, modifications, and looking into the internal systems of the car, including the battery pack. On TeslaMotorsClub what started as a thread about battery pack capacities not matching advertized amounts, rated amount of available energy doesn't even match the car's own reported energy , turned into a thread called Pack Performance and Launch Mode Limits . This thread has kicked off a bit of a firestorm as these performance limits weren't documented or disclosed. It appears pretty clear that Tesla is counting the number of Launches (done through launch mode), as well as the number of Wide Open Throttle (WoT) events. Reflections on Tesla's Autopilot 2.0

Tesla announced an upgrade to their autopilot sensor suite on October 19th, to be installed on all cars produced as of that day. This new sensor suite is being called Autopilot 2.0, or AP 2.0 for short, on forums. AP 2.0 adds several additional cameras and improves the ultrasonic sensors. It's also a big improvement in the visual processing hardware required to process the sensor data. You can read about it on Tesla's Autopilot page . Tesla's claim is that this system will be able to achieve "Full Self-Driving capability". The description of the systems capabilities matches the highest SAE vehicle automation level of 5 where the human has only to set the destination and activate the system. The increase in capabilities between AP 1.0 and AP 2.0 has caused a significant emotional response across the range of existing Tesla owners, especially as Elon has confirmed that there is no option for retrofitting. Tesla Model S - Cost of driving, electric vs. gasoline

I've had a Tesla Model S for a few months now. How much does it cost me to drive it each day? Electric vehicles are more efficient than gasoline vehicles. fueleconomy.gov says : " Electric vehicles  convert about 59%–62% of the electrical energy from the grid to power at the wheels—conventional  gasoline vehicles  only convert about 17%–21% of the energy stored in  gasoline  to power at the wheels." Given an electric vehicles (EVs) increased efficiency, current electric rates, and gasoline prices, are you saving money on a per-mile basis when driving an EV? Tesla provides a calculator on their website to help people estimate the cost and cost savings between electric and gasoline cars. Tesla's calculator says it would cost $3.41 for electricity and $7.52 for gasoline for my typical daily commute of about 84 miles round trip. Electricty cost analysis - Flat rate vs. time-of-use metering

Our electric provider here in North Reading, Reading Municipal Light Department (RMLD) (http://www.rmld.com/), offers time-of-use and net metering as two alternative electricity tariffs to the standard flat rate. If your electric provider has these two options, how could you determine if either or both of these options would reduce your electric bill? Net metering is typically used by people that are generating as well as consuming electricity, for instance if you had a solar photovoltaic system. If you had solar you would very likely already have net metering, without a meter that supported net metering your solar system could be generating power and you wouldn't receive any credit for it. Time-of-use (TOU) tariffs vary electric rates based on time of day. TOU rates are commonly used by electric companies to help shape electric demand by increasing the cost of electricity during some periods and discounting it during others. Tesla's disruption in the car industry

As a follower of technology companies and products I've been watching Tesla Motors  for years. With the Model S , Tesla has produced a luxury car that has raised the bar in terms of usability, features, performance, and safety and scored a near perfect score in Consumer Reports review. Tesla appears to be putting significant pressure on luxury car brands. The Model S  outsold, in the first half of 2013, Porsche, Jaguar and Land Rover  in California and in the first quarter of 2013  some models of Audi, BMW and Lexus . At this point, demand for the Model S appears to be outpacing production capacity. The current delivery wait on the Model S is two months or more, as indicated on the Tesla website. Today, at ~$70k USD, the Model S is in a different market segment and significantly more expensive than the the biggest selling EVs on the market.
